the Dino Hunter

When the Gi Joe team had the seemingly improbable task of hunting dinosaurs on Cobra Island (remember, Cobra does employ the likes of Dr. Mindbender), they needed a rugged vehicle with which to tussle against the reptiles - and to flee fast if things got out of control.

This is why they returned to an earlier design, the Desert Fox. Giving its muted brown coloration a seriously blue and white overhaul, the Joes equipped it to take on Cobra's genetic terrors. The newly christened Dinosaur Hunter has these capabilities:

Body Armor (s): the Dino Hunter is built tough. It has an armored radiator, a stiffened roll bar, and three-layer modular wheels (with self-sealing foam and a 'bullet proof' rating), a total package that provides the vehicle and its occupants +3 protection.

Communications Array (i): the Dino Hunter is equipped with a gigahertz frequency, frequency wobbler clandestine operations radio system. This makes for intensity 6 communications power (with a 250 mile range) that has intensity 10 signal encryption.

Deflection (i): the Dino Hunter's front end is engineered with a ballistic shape in mind, in order to best avoid incoming damage. Any attack coming from the front of the Dino Hunter has to contend with a -2 worth of deflection, no matter its type or origins.

Lightning Lamps (i): these hood-mounted, high-intensity off-road head-laps allow the Dino Hunter to operate night or day. They can fill an area with intensity 8 light, and in the right conditions can provide an excellent blinding attack.

Lightning Speed (a): there's no two bones about it, the Dino Hunter is fast on its six wheels - why else do you think its drivers like it so? The Dino Hunter has this ability at intensity 4, allowing it to move at approximately 120 m.p.h.

Sonic Anti-dinosaur Missiles (i): the Dino Hunter has two surface to surface anti-dinosaur missiles mounted on its roll cage. These powerful projectiles can be used as blunt instruments, inflicting intensity 10 damage, and often do after fulfilling their primary purpose.

Unlike most missiles however, these devices are not meant to be lethal. You see, they can emit a powerful burst of sonic energy, attenuated carefully to produce an intensity 10 stunning effect (per Stun Blast); those exposed to this effect must resist with their Willpower instead of Strength.

Xenon Lamps (i): in addition to its regular driving lamps, the Dino Hunter has a second set of lights - this one mounted on the roll cage of the vehicle. These also provide intensity 8 illumination, but can be used with the others to boost the total value by +2.
